Before wiring the LCD screen to your Arduino board we suggest to solder a pin header strip to the 14 (or 16) pin count connector of the LCD screen, as you can see in the image further up.

To start with, you will create a demonstration project that will show off most of the functions available in the LiquidCrystal.h library. To do so, you’ll use a backlit 16x2 LCD Display. 

Project 23 Liquid Crystal Displays -Hello World!

LCD_16x2 pin

To wire your LCD screen to your board, connect the following pins:

  • LCD RS pin to digital pin 9

  • LCD Enable pin to digital pin 8

  • LCD D4 pin to digital pin 5

  • LCD D5 pin to digital pin 4

  • LCD D6 pin to digital pin 3

  • LCD D7 pin to digital pin 2

  • LCD R/W pin to GND

  • LCD VSS pin to GND

  • LCD VCC pin to 5V

  • LCD LED+ to 5V through a 220 ohm resistor

  • LCD LED- to GND

Arduino LCD Diagram 16X2

Additionally, wire a 10k potentiometer to +5V and GND, with it's wiper (output) to LCD screens VO pin (pin3).

#include <LiquidCrystal.h>
// initialize the library by associating any needed LCD interface pin
// with the arduino pin number it is connected to
const int rs = 9, en = 8, d4 = 5, d5 = 4, d6 = 3, d7 = 2;
LiquidCrystal lcd(rs, en, d4, d5, d6, d7);
void setup() {
  // set up the LCD's number of columns and rows:
  lcd.begin(16, 2);
  // Print a message to the LCD.
  lcd.print("Hello, World!");
}
void loop() {
  // set the cursor to column 0, line 1
  // (note: line 1 is the second row, since counting begins with 0):
  lcd.setCursor(0, 1);
  // print the number of seconds since reset:
  lcd.print(millis() / 1000);
}

Project 23-1 Liquid Crystal Displays - Text Direction Example

#include <LiquidCrystal.h>
// Initialize the library with the numbers of the interface pins
const int rs = 9, en = 8, d4 = 5, d5 = 4, d6 = 3, d7 = 2;
LiquidCrystal lcd(rs, en, d4, d5, d6, d7);
int thisChar = 'a';
void setup() {
  // set up the LCD's number of columns and rows:
  lcd.begin(16, 2);
  // turn on the cursor:
  lcd.cursor();
}
void loop() {
  // reverse directions at 'm':
  if (thisChar == 'm') {
    // go right for the next letter
    lcd.rightToLeft();
  }
  // reverse again at 's':
  if (thisChar == 's') {
    // go left for the next letter
    lcd.leftToRight();
  }
  // reset at 'z':
  if (thisChar > 'z') {
    // go to (0,0):
    lcd.home();
    // start again at 0
    thisChar = 'a';
  }
  // print the character
  lcd.write(thisChar);
  // wait a second:
  delay(1000);
  // increment the letter:
  thisChar++;
}
